Rijnzicht, Doornenburg
Netherlands, Doornenburg, Forum
"Mike Cornelissen's cuisine is still bursting with exuberant ideas, sometimes playful, but always cleverly composed. The craftsmanship is flawless anyway. The relaxed atmosphere, to which the chefs contribute by serving and explaining the dishes, is a perfect match. Carolien Cornelissen-van der Velde, who is both the restaurant manager and sommelier, looks after the guests warmly and we appreciate the fact that she does it for our table in German all the more." (Published in September 2024)
